Repeated thermal shocks
Many believe that a modern thermostat is enough to protect their paintings, but the reality is more subtle. The classic on/off cycles create temperature variations of 3 to 5°C every hour, imperceptible to us but dramatic for an old canvas.
Think of a saucepan on the fire: even if the average temperature remains constant, the hot/cold alternations end up stressing the metal. The same thing happens to the fibers of your canvas.
These micro-traumas accumulate silently and explain why some collectors discover sudden degradation after several years of seemingly problem-free exposure.

Step 1: Laying the Foundation for a Stable Climate
Starting with this step is essential as it lays the foundation for stability, like solid foundations for a house. Without this base, all future adjustments will remain fragile. Once you master this step, you'll already feel a new serenity when looking at your artworks.
🛠️ Essential Equipment
- Inverter air conditioning system: recognizable by its technology that adjusts power continuously rather than stopping/restarting. Available from all air conditioning specialists, choose a model with regulation to within 0.5°C. Avoid low-end models that promise the same performance for half the price: they don't have the necessary precision. Precision hygrometer: a small digital unit that displays temperature AND humidity with decimals. The principle: it gives you the "vital signs" of your environment in real time. Check that it indicates +/- 1% accuracy. This objective data will transform your approach to preservation. Adjustable air diffusers: elements that are attached to ventilation grilles to redirect the airflow. They create a gentle circulation instead of the traditional direct "jet". The visible benefit: no more areas of aggressive drafts around your paintings.Let's move on to concrete implementation now
🎯 Actions to take for this first step
Install the reference hygrometer: place it exactly halfway between your main painting and the air conditioning source, at eye level. This position gives you the most representative measurement of what your canvas "feels". Placement is crucial as it determines the reliability of all your future decisions.
⏱️ Time: 10 minutes | ✅ Successful when: the display is stable for 30 minutes and shows temperature and humidity | ⚠️ Attention: do not place it near a window or heat source, as this would completely distort the measurements
Set the "maintain" mode of your air conditioner: activate the mode that avoids complete stops (often called "eco inverter" or "smart”). Set it to 21°C and let it run for 24 hours to observe variations. This continuity prevents destructive thermal shocks to your artworks.
⏱️ Time: 5 minutes of adjustment + 24 hours of observation | ✅ Successful when: variations remain below 1.5°C | ⚠️ Attention: resist the temptation to "correct" too quickly, let the system stabilize naturally
Direct airflow: direct all ventilation grilles towards the ceiling or side walls, never directly at the artworks. Use your diffusers to create a "bouncing" circulation. This technique reproduces the gentle natural ventilation of museums.
⏱️ Time: 20 minutes | ✅ Successful when: no direct current reaches your artworks | ⚠️ Caution: many forget about return air vents which can also create harmful aspirations
✅ Validation of step 1: after 48 hours, your humidity measurements should show variations less than 5%, and the temperature must remain within a range of 2°C maximum.
